Overview:

Southern Union State Community College (SUSCC) is a public, two-year college in Alabama, part of the Alabama Community College System. It offers a variety of academic, technical, and health science programs designed to be affordable, accessible, equitable, and responsive to the needs of its students, community, and businesses.

    Three Conveniently Located Campuses:

    Campuses in Wadley, Opelika, and Valley.

Academic Programs:

SUSCC offers a diverse range of academic programs, including:

    Academic Division:

    A variety of academic programs leading to Associate in Arts and Associate in Science degrees.

    Health Sciences:

    Programs in nursing, medical assisting, and other healthcare fields.

    Technical Education:

    Programs in fields such as welding, automotive technology, and computer science.

    Adult Education:

    Programs for adults seeking to earn a high school diploma or GED.

    Continuing Education:

    A variety of non-credit courses and programs for personal and professional development.

    Distance Education:

    Online courses and programs for students who prefer flexible learning options.

    Dual Enrollment:

    Opportunities for high school students to earn college credit.

    Concurrent Enrollment:

    Opportunities for students to work on their Associate in Science degree and their bachelor's degree at the same time.

    Saturday College:

    Weekend classes for students who prefer a flexible schedule.

    Fast Track Programs:

    Accelerated programs for students who want to complete their degree quickly.

    Ascend:

    A program for students who want to transfer to a four-year university.

    Accelerated High School:

    A program for high school students who want to graduate early.

Other:

  • SUSCC is an open admission college, meaning that anyone who meets the minimum requirements can apply.
  • The college is accredited by the Southern Association of Colleges and Schools Commission on Colleges.
